Well you know something, there's been lots of documented cases of people being killed by dogs but never even a suggestion of an adult being killed by a cat. Even the suggestion that a cat might sleep on a baby and suffocate it is silly if you ask me.

Cats are very curious, that's why she watchs you. She rubs up against you as a sign of affection, she is marking you as her own. She may play at attacking things, including you if you happen to be handy, but that's just play. Try getting a cat toy and shaking it around in front of her and watch her "killing" it, it's incredible funny. Another great cat game is put her and a ping pong ball in an empty bath, it's hysterical to watch. (make sure you hide the ping pong ball at night though, that game is no fun at 3am!) If you get used to playing with her you will probably feel more relaxed about her. Occasionally she may accidentally scratch you, cats have very sharp claws, but they rarely attack on purpose unless they are really scared or upset.

Cats often stare. Sometimes they are just trying to gain control as they would with another cat. Just look away and do something else. You will find if you narrow your eyes slightly for a brief second it will help. Cats see that as a sign of friendship.
Another constant stare is the "feed me now" type. In which case you will get no respite until you do what the cat wants!
Please don't be scared, the cat is just trying to get to know you, suss out what he/she can get away with.
If the cat approaches you with its tail erect that is another sign it feels friendly.
Good luck. Cats are fascinating creatures with some quirky personality traits. Sure you will end up getting on fine.
